Output 4ddf336683404ad07c76c143ffd1aa8f819c500d514836d9f8500255280723a6:1

value
17528
script pubkey
OP_0 OP_PUSHBYTES_20 2e3b5c9759c1a25d8aadaf9746a7d0e7dc52610f
address
tb1q9ca4e96ecx39mz4d47t5df7sulw9ycg0nxa988
transaction
4ddf336683404ad07c76c143ffd1aa8f819c500d514836d9f8500255280723a6